And they've also reintroduced the tax-cut for the lowest income-tax bracket from 15.5% back down to 15%, retroactive to January 2007. In other words, their .5% raise on the original Liberal tax-cut was just completely undone. So people in that tax bracket should enjoy that. I don't know if that affects me or not... but people getting to keep their money is a good thing in my book. |
Yes it affects you. Every single tax paying canadian pays 15% on about 28 of your first 37 thousand made. The other 9000 is the basic personal amount and is therefore non taxable. Only on dollars between 37-75 thousand will you pay at the second rate of 23%. this continues as you move up into the brackets. This prevents the common misconseption that one can make less take home money due to being bumped into the next bracket.
